Help your class find the the magnetic field of a toroid, a solenoid bent into a circle with an activity that allows the class to see how a loop of wire carrying an electrical charge behaves much like a magnet. The resource provides the teacher information to develop a lecture on Ampere's Law, which in turn allows pupils calculate the magnetic field around a loop and a toroid.
